After the try again suggestion failing, I cd'd to
G:/installs/cygwin/packages/ftp%3a%2f%2fmirrors.kernel.org%2fsourceware%2fcygwi
n%2f/release
and did a mkdir -p GNOME/_obsolete/atk.
Then I tried setup again, and it got past that package and came
to another where it claimed it couldn't write to base-cygwin.
So I did a mkdir base-cygwin and tried again.
Then it got to where it claimed it couldn't write to base-files,
so I did a mkdir base-files.
Then it got to where it claimed it couldn't write to base-passwd,
so I decided this is getting very very old.
Something isn't right. Yet, 1.5.25 never had such troubles
in this directory....
